Woman robbed at bank deposit slot

Police are trying to identify a robber who held up a woman making a night deposit at a Rhawnhurst bank on Sept. 17.

The crime occurred at Wells Fargo at 7400 Bustleton Ave. at about 7:54 p.m., police said. Surveillance video from the bank shows the 40-year-old victim approaching the night deposit slot with a bank bag, followed by a man approaching an ATM positioned next to the deposit slot. At first, the suspect appeared as if he was going to make a withdrawal, but he then grabbed the victim’s bank bag and ran to the parking lot of a nearby Sears store, where he entered a vehicle, possibly a Chrysler Sebring, driven by another person and fled the area.

The robber was described as black, 30 years old and 6 feet tall, with short hair, a black baseball cap, leather jacket and sneakers. To view the surveillance video, visit the Philadelphia Police channel on YouTube.com. Call police at 215–686-TIPS or text to PPD TIP to report information. ••
